Output d896b68b6cd3148ad73390d66456103e2b4cfd59592352fff3d6ed9b2985cbc5:0

value
90520000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 554b89b5313801143616fe7de5cab411f5a6160c OP_EQUALVERIFY OP_CHECKSIG
address
18mzvmoBoZDEQis9gZHm9RwaxbJTH6xm2L
transaction
d896b68b6cd3148ad73390d66456103e2b4cfd59592352fff3d6ed9b2985cbc5
confirmations
306527
spent
true